MCBE Studio
Mod called “MCBE Studio” for Minecraft Bedrock version 1.12 allows you to use time intervals in the game version. The mod’s API is simple, it cannot be compared to more serious add-ons, but with its help, you can place keyframes in the world that interpolate to create a sequence.
In the graphical interface of Minecraft, there is a button “Open Mcbe Studio”. Due to the lack of event handlers in the API, currently the only way to open the main interface is to open any game interface (pause, inventory, chat…), direct the mouse cursor to where the button is located, and exit the interface using a keyboard combination.

Below the timeline, there are several buttons to navigate to the previous and next frame, as well as to the first and last. There is also a play/pause button and an unused button that will allow you to play the sequence without the interface.
In keyframe mode, punch the armor stand in front of you to place a keyframe, exit keyframe mode, then stop and turn to punch another.
